Understanding Crypto Signals

At its core, crypto signals are trade recommendations generated by experienced traders or through automated algorithms. These signals can indicate when to buy or sell a particular cryptocurrency based on various forms of analysis, including technical analysis, fundamental analysis, and sentiment analysis. For many, these recommendations serve as crucial information that can save time and possibly lead to financial gains.

Types of Crypto Signals

  • Market Sentiment Signals: These utilize data from social media platforms, forums, and news outlets to gauge the general market mood regarding specific cryptocurrencies.
  • Technical Analysis Signals: These are based on historical price data and involve indicators like Moving Averages, Relative Strength Index (RSI), and Bollinger Bands.
  • Fundamental Analysis Signals: These signals consider underlying factors such as market capitalization, project developments, and regulatory news that might influence a cryptocurrency's long-term value.
  • On-chain Signal Analysis: These signals analyze blockchain data, such as transaction volumes and wallet activity, providing insights into the actual use and acceptance of a cryptocurrency.

Evaluating Crypto Signals: What to Look For

When assessing the viability of a crypto signal, consider the following factors:

1. Accuracy Rate

A credible crypto signal provider should offer transparency regarding their success rates. High accuracy rates typically correlate with a provider's reliability. However, keep in mind that past performance is not a guarantee of future results.

2. Risk Management Features

Good signals should incorporate risk management features. This could include stop-loss suggestions, recommended trade sizes, and other techniques to help you minimize potential losses. I always emphasize to new traders the importance of managing risk proactively.

3. Community Feedback

Research user experiences and feedback about the signal provider. Reliable sources often have active communities that share their results and insights. Platforms like Reddit and specialized forums can be great for gathering community opinions.

Best Practices for Using Crypto Signals

While having access to crypto signals is invaluable, it's crucial to approach them wisely. Here are some practices I recommend:

1. Combine Signals with Your Own Analysis

Never rely solely on external signals. Make sure to conduct your own analysis to confirm the recommendations. Merging signals with your understanding of market trends can enhance your decision-making process.

2. Start Small

When beginning, test the waters by making small trades based on signals. This will help you gauge both their effectiveness and your comfort level with trading without exposing yourself to significant financial risk.

3. Keep Learning

The cryptocurrency space is rapidly evolving. Always stay informed by keeping up with industry news and trends. Education is your best ally in making prudent trading decisions.
